Ethnic Distribution of Callaway

According to the US Census, the Callaway surname is distributed across the following ethnic groups. This data reflects self-reported ethnicity among 13,819 Americans with the Callaway last name.

White 78.33%
Black 16.32%
Hispanic 2.45%
Asian/PI 0.44%
Native American 0.6%
Two+ Races 1.87%
